What is the Polyvagal Theory?

The Polyvagal Theory, developed by Dr. Stephen Porges, is a groundbreaking framework that explains how the autonomic nervous system (ANS) regulates our responses to safety, danger, and life-threatening situations. It focuses on the interplay between the ANS and our emotional and behavioral reactions, emphasizing the role of the vagus nerve in maintaining equilibrium. The theory introduces the concept of “neuroception,” the process by which the nervous system detects cues of safety or threat in the environment. By understanding this system, individuals can better navigate stress and trauma, fostering emotional resilience. The theory is particularly valuable for those seeking to enhance emotional regulation and connection, offering a scientifically grounded approach to well-being and recovery.

The Three Branches of the Autonomic Nervous System

The autonomic nervous system (ANS) is composed of three distinct branches, each serving unique functions in response to environmental cues. The ventral vagal complex is the most advanced branch, enabling social engagement, communication, and connection. It promotes feelings of safety and calmness, facilitating cooperation and empathy. The sympathetic nervous system activates the “fight-or-flight” response, preparing the body to react to perceived threats by increasing heart rate and energy levels. Lastly, the dorsal vagal complex is the most primitive branch, responsible for the “freeze” response, often manifesting as immobilization in life-threatening situations. Together, these branches operate hierarchically, with the ventral vagal complex taking precedence when safety is perceived. Understanding these branches is essential for applying Polyvagal Theory exercises to regulate emotional responses and enhance resilience.

Understanding the Vagus Nerve

The vagus nerve, often referred to as the “wanderer,” is the most complex and influential nerve in the parasympathetic nervous system; It plays a crucial role in regulating heart rate, digestion, and respiratory patterns, while also enabling social engagement and communication. The vagus nerve operates bidirectionally, transmitting signals between the brain and various bodily organs. When activated, it promotes relaxation, reduces stress hormones like cortisol, and fosters a sense of calm. Polyvagal Theory emphasizes the importance of vagal tone, the nerve’s efficiency in regulating these processes. Higher vagal tone is associated with better emotional resilience and overall well-being. Exercises such as deep breathing, mindful movement, and vocal practices are designed to stimulate the vagus nerve, enhancing its function and contributing to improved emotional regulation and health.

How the Polyvagal Theory Explains Stress Responses

The Polyvagal Theory, developed by Dr. Stephen Porges, offers a comprehensive understanding of how the autonomic nervous system (ANS) responds to stress. According to the theory, the ANS operates through a hierarchy of responses designed to ensure survival. The first response is the ventral vagal complex, associated with social engagement and safety, allowing us to connect and seek help. If this fails, the body activates the sympathetic “fight or flight” response, preparing to confront or escape danger. As a last resort, the dorsal vagal complex initiates a “freeze” response, a state of immobilization.

This hierarchical model is guided by neuroception, a subconscious process that continually assesses safety or danger in the environment. Chronic stress can disrupt this system, leading to poorer emotional regulation and heightened stress reactivity. Understanding these responses through the Polyvagal lens provides a biological basis for addressing stress, aiding in the development of targeted interventions to enhance resilience and well-being.

The Concept of Neuroception and Safety

Neuroception, a term coined by Dr. Stephen Porges, refers to the automatic process by which our nervous system evaluates safety or danger in the environment. This subconscious assessment is crucial for determining our autonomic responses, whether it’s relaxation, fight-or-flight, or freezing. Safety cues, such as a warm tone of voice or a reassuring presence, activate the ventral vagal complex, fostering connection and calmness. Conversely, perceived threats trigger sympathetic activation or dorsal vagal responses, prioritizing survival over social engagement. Chronic misjudgments of safety can lead to emotional dysregulation and stress-related conditions. Understanding neuroception helps us address these challenges by identifying and strengthening pathways that promote feelings of safety, resilience, and emotional balance.

Deep Breathing Exercises to Stimulate the Vagus Nerve

Deep breathing is a powerful tool to activate the vagus nerve, promoting relaxation and reducing stress. By focusing on slow, deliberate breaths, individuals can engage the parasympathetic nervous system, fostering a calm state. Techniques include diaphragmatic breathing, where the abdomen rises with each inhale, and controlled exhales to extend relaxation. Regular practice enhances vagal tone, improving emotional resilience. PDF guides often outline these exercises, providing clear instructions for consistent practice. These exercises are especially beneficial for those seeking to manage anxiety or recover from traumatic experiences, offering a simple yet effective way to restore nervous system balance and promote overall well-being.

Vocal Exercises to Enhance Vagal Tone

Vocal exercises are a key component of Polyvagal Theory practices, designed to strengthen the vagus nerve and promote emotional regulation. Activities like humming, chanting, or toning engage the vagal nerve, stimulating the parasympathetic response and fostering calm. These exercises often involve controlled breathing and intentional sound production, which can help regulate the autonomic nervous system. By activating the vagus nerve, vocal exercises enhance vagal tone, improving the body’s ability to respond to stress and promoting a sense of safety. Many Polyvagal Theory PDF guides include specific vocal techniques, such as vowel sound exercises or resonant breathing, to encourage nervous system balance. Regular practice can lead to increased emotional resilience and a greater capacity for connection and relaxation in daily life. Vocal exercises are simple yet effective tools for enhancing vagal function and overall well-being.

Recommended Books on Polyvagal Theory

Several books provide in-depth insights into Polyvagal Theory and its practical applications. “The Polyvagal Theory in Therapy” by Deb Dana offers a user-friendly guide to understanding the autonomic nervous system and its role in therapy. “Clinical Applications of the Polyvagal Theory” by Stephen Porges and Deb Dana explores practical strategies for clinicians. “Polyvagal Safety: Attachment, Communication, Self-Regulation” by Stephen Porges is a seminal work that dives into the theory’s foundations. These books, often available in PDF formats, are invaluable for professionals and individuals seeking to understand and apply Polyvagal principles. They provide step-by-step exercises, case studies, and real-world applications, making them essential resources for emotional regulation and trauma recovery.
